Cabinet demolition services involve the careful removal of existing cabinets from a property, typically in kitchens, bathrooms, or utility areas. This process includes disconnecting plumbing, electrical components, and securely taking out cabinets without damaging surrounding surfaces.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the removal is thorough and efficient, preparing the space for renovation, remodeling, or new installations. These services are essential when old cabinets no longer serve the needs of the household or are in poor condition, making way for updated or more functional storage solutions.

The overview below groups typical Cabinet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Gary, IN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or cabinet demolition projects such as removing a few cabinets or updating a kitchen,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and scope of the demolition.

Partial Demolition - When only part of a cabinet setup needs to be removed or replaced, costs generally range from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common and usually involve moderate complexity, with fewer jobs reaching higher prices.

Full Cabinet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of kitchen cabinets often costs between $2,000 and $5,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, especially if additional work like wall repairs or custom cabinetry is needed.

Custom or Complex Projects - For extensive demolition involving structural changes or custom cabinetry removal, costs can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common and typically involve detailed planning and specialized labor from local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What does cabinet demolition involve? Cabinet demolition typically includes removing existing cabinets, hardware, and related fixtures from a space, preparing the area for renovation or new installations.

Are there different types of cabinet demolition services? Yes, local contractors may offer partial demolition, such as removing upper cabinets only, or full demolition of all cabinetry in a room.

What should I consider before hiring a cabinet demolition service? It's important to assess the scope of the project, the condition of the cabinets, and any potential need for disposal or recycling of old materials.

Can cabinet demolition be combined with other renovation services? Yes, many service providers can coordinate cabinet removal with countertop replacement, wall repairs, or other remodeling tasks.

How do local contractors ensure proper disposal of old cabinets? Service providers typically handle the removal and disposal of old cabinets in accordance with local regulations, ensuring environmentally responsible practices.
